KMS Tools, Coquitlam now has on site mix aerosol paint. Bring in your paint code (from the registration plate) and they will mix aerosol cans on site. Cost is 19.95 plus tax.

To date I haven't found anyone that willl make up spray cans from paint codes for this price. I couldn't just buy one can, I had to buy a case.

KMS actually mixes the paint and injects it into the aerosol can, two coats recommended, and spray clear coat over top. Princess Auto sells clear coat for $6 a can.

It's good for small touch ups.
